** Adding onto this, Sniper is also capable of exploiting Heavy’s movement speed by taking the time to aim and headshot him. So why doesn’t Heavy share the same disdain towards Sniper as he does Spy? Because unlike Spy’s backstabs, Sniper’s headshots aren’t a guaranteed instakill. While it ''is'' true that a fully charged headshot can take out Heavy even when he’s at full health, it takes ''two'' fully charged headshots to take down Heavy when he’s overhealed. And that’s assuming Sniper feels like taking the time to charge said headshot; otherwise it can take ''three'' headshots to kill Heavy, and by that time, unless Sniper is a reasonable distance away, he’ll be lucky if Heavy doesn’t find and gun him down first.
